Ogden Museum of Southern Art’s “Magnolia Ball”

The Ogden Museum of Southern Art hosted the eighth annual “Magnolia Ball” on Saturday, June 12. The event celebrated the exhibition “Outside In, Improvisations of Space: The Ceramic Work of MaPó Kinnord,” which brought together works from throughout Kinnord’s career to illustrate her practice in clay.

Patrons safely experienced art, live music, DJs, entertainers, an online silent auction, food vouchers from local restaurants, cocktails and more in a socially distanced, masked program that offered timed ticket options.

Entertainment for the evening included live painting by Becky Fos, live painting by Ellen Langford, live nail set painting by M.A.D. Nails and performances by the 610 Stompers. Musical entertainment included DJ Heelturn, DJ Jess, DJ RQ Away and the People Museum Band.

The online silent auction featured more than 90 regional artists and businesses, including Artemis Antippas, French Truck Coffee, Richard McCabe, Whitson Ramsey, Saint Claude Social Club, The Sazerac House and Katie Dumestre Yaquinto. Bidding opened on June 5, and the silent auction was on view at Ogden Museum from May 29 through June 13. In a collaborative effort to support both the museum and the community, silent auction artists and businesses received a portion of final sales.

Prior to the ball, the “Kickoff Party” took place on Saturday, May 15, at the studio of New Orleans artist William Monaghan, and featured live music and drinks.

Chairing the 2021 “Magnolia Ball” were Shannon Moon, Matthew Moreland, Meghan Parson, Patrick Welsh, Sharonda Williams and Justin Woods.
